We are sailing Allure next November Eastern Carb. and from what I have read it appears that MDR seatings are 6pm and 8:45.

 

BUT when I just updated my preferences under onboard preference it gives the times of:

 

5:30 and 6:30 for My Family Dining

 

and

 

5:30

6:30

8:30

9:30 for traditional dining

 

For MTD it says you can reserve a table between the hours of 6:00 and 9:30.

 

If dining is at 6:30 I will go with My family Time Dining but if it's 6pm I will end up with MTD.

 

Can anyone clarify this??? I tried to cut and pasted the entire section but it wouldn't let me. I found it under crown and anchor onboard preferences.

I believe the MFTD is set up to seat people doing that relatively close in one area so the Adventure Ocean staff that pick up the kids can do that more efficiently. Hence a different time for that. Not sure though about all the different times for MDR seatings but the site may be trying to accomodate multiple ship options with one set of preferences and they will set the closest time that fits the preference.
